French Constitutional Council's Impartiality Questioned Over Assisted Dying Law
Concerns have been raised regarding the impartiality of France's Constitutional Council as it prepares to review a new law on assisted dying. Critics argue that several members of the council have already taken public positions on the text, potentially compromising its neutrality.
